Getting there

About 140 km south, about two hours by car on the Daraa road. Some visitor pages say 2.5 to 3. A hired car is the comfortable version; agree the wait and the cash before you leave. Garage names disagree and have moved: older notes said Baramkeh; a February 2026 independent thread said direct buses to Bosra al-Sham exist; Arabic 2026 pages still send people via Daraa then a taxi east, about 40 km. Arabic notes in July 2026 said the Daraa garage had left Bab Musalla — some name al-Tadamon at Dawaar al-Battikh, a governorate note named Sharia al-Thalathin. Do not go to Harasta for this — that bay is north, the M5. Ask the hotel which southbound bay is running. Confirm the last seat back that morning. You may need a night if they strand you — that is the warning, not a hotel list. Sleep is Damascus. Do not add this to the seven-day line. Getting around Syria has the same note.

A day here

  1. 1Leave Damascus in the morning. South, not the M5. Shared car or driver, or the garage the hotel names.
  2. 2Cash pounds at the citadel gate. The theatre is inside later walls. Steep stairs; staff can point to an easier way onto the stage.
  3. 3Walk the seating, then the basalt lanes. Neighbourhood, not a museum pair. Mosque if open: modest dress. Same castle gate in operator notes.
  4. 4Be on the road back to Damascus in daylight. Last seats have been early. Seats thin out in the afternoon. If they strand you, that is the night this page warned about.
  5. 5Do not add Suwayda, Shahba, or the seven-day north. That is a different holiday.
